Heart Disease Surge in 30s, Middle-Aged Adults: Survey Finds
Wockhardt Hospitals Survey Reveals Rising Risks Among Middle-Aged and Young Adults

Heart disease is striking younger adults in the city like never before. A month-long Heart Health Insights Survey by Wockhardt Hospitals, Mumbai Central, has revealed that two-thirds of city doctors report a sharp rise in cardiac cases among people under 40, while middle-aged adults (41–60 years) continue to be the highest-risk group.

“Ten years ago, heart attacks in the 30s were rare. Today, we see professionals in their late 20s and 30s arriving in ERs with stress-driven cardiac emergencies. This is an alarming urban health crisis,” warned Dr Gulshan Rohra, Chief CVTS, Wockhardt Hospitals, Mumbai Central.

The survey shows that preventive heart screening is still far from routine — only 1 in 3 Mumbaikars gets regular preventive checks. Most people seek help only after symptoms appear, often missing the ‘golden hour’ that can save lives.

“Even educated patients underestimate their cardiac risk. By the time they reach us, the window for quick recovery is lost. Prevention and awareness must be Mumbai’s top health priorities,” said Dr Parin Sangoi, Consultant Interventional Cardiologist.

Further insights reveal that 70% of patients are only partly aware of their BP, cholesterol, and sugar levels, while over half cannot recognize early warning signs of heart attack such as chest pain, sweating, and breathlessness.

“Awareness, speed, and access to care are the three pillars of survival. We at Wockhardt are committed to bridging these gaps through partnerships with doctors, communities, and the media,” said Dr Virendra Chauhan, Centre Head, Wockhardt Hospitals, Mumbai Central.
